Tuesday, March 3, 2015

9 Ways To Learn How To Code!



 Programming is one of the most important skills to boost your career in IT. Programming sharpens your logical thinking and improves your productivity. Learning curve of programming is quite interesting too. In today’s world, programming has become one of the essential factor in getting a job. Here are nine tips and resources to help you learn how to code.



1. Why Do You Want To Learn: 

First decide the direction before getting on the track. If you want to be professional programmer, figure out why do you want to be. Try to evaluate your areas of interest and skillset. You can sign up for professional courses. There are many websites that offer professional course for programming. Google has a list of suggested skills and courses for software engineer aspirants.

2. Right Language: 

The first programming language that you learn is very important as it is the fundamental step for your career as a programmer. Remember that there is nothing such as ‘best programming language’. All programming languages have their merits and demerits. Some languages are more beginner-friendly than rest. Experts suggest that always start with machine level language like C or C++.

3. Start Small: 

Irrespective of what language you choose, you should start at very beginning. You can learn how to code in eight weeks a;so. But you should start with introductory part, do not start with advance level of programing tutorials. Start with basics and be patient as you progress. Practice a lot and break down the practice project in simple steps for better understanding.

4. App Designed For Kids: 

There are many programs and courses that are designed to teach kids how to code. Some educational projects like Scratch.jr are very helpful. You should definitely give it a try in the process of learning how to code. You can start with basics of programming with fundamental courses online.

5. Use Online Training Sites: 

There are lot of free online training sites like Codeacademy, Edex, Udemy which offer great courses. You can use tutorials from KhanAcademy, code.org and many other organisations which have brilliant introductory tutorial that teaches basics of programming.

6. Take A Course: 

Online Computer Science courses offer a great educational experience as compared to offline training at educational academy and university. Some online courses are designed to teach you fundamental skills that are required to become a programmer. You can even build a university level computer science education with help of free online courses.

7. Free Programming Books: 

You can find number of online tutorial books and PDFs that are really helpful in learning how to code. There is a huge collection of free books available on Github that covers over 24 programming languages. Books come very handy as they have detailed how-to guide and tutorials.

8. Coding Games: 

Coding games are great tool to learn programming. You can easily build simple or complex games for yourself. Some teaching sites like Code Combat and CodinGame are great tools to build coding games in an efficient way.

9. Mentor: 

Getting a mentor is the best option for learning how to code. Online communities are very active and helping programmers. Online sites like Hack.pledge() connect you to a mentor or you can sign up to mentor someone. Sharing the knowledge is best way to nurture it.

Courtesy:- EFYTIMES News Network

1 comment: